在Java 项目目录设计领域,广大开发者曾长期面临“找到源码”、“理解架构”与“快速重构”的三重痛点,这已成为制约Java 开发效能提升的关键瓶颈。

传统的瀑布式开发模式往往导致项目结构随意,大量重复代码共享于同目录,而数据分区逻辑模糊,使得在引入新技术或引入新功能时,不得不进行痛苦的代码迁移与重构。
现代Java 项目目录建设旨在通过模块化的分层策略,实现业务逻辑、基础设施与服务的解耦,同时建立明确的版本控制与发布机制,确保Java 应用在复杂环境下的高可用性与可扩展性。
一、标准化目录结构:确保代码的一致性与可维护性
构建标准化的Java 项目目录,首先必须确立一套全局统一的编码规范,包括类名、包名、接口与实体类的命名规则,以及模块间的依赖关系。